Vehicle crash near Greenfield Rd damages utility pole, Detroit MI
A vehicle accident occurred near Greenfield Rd between Margarita and Pickford. The crash involved a gray Dodge Charger and caused damage to a wooden utility pole, which is leaning. Emergency crews responded but found no injured person. The utility company needs to repair the pole.
